30 /* DEVICE
31
32 core - root of the device tree
33
34 DESCRIPTION
35
36 The core device positioned at the root of the device tree appears
37 to its child devices as a normal device just like every other
38 device in the tree.
39
40 Internally it is implemented using a core object. Requests to
41 attach (or detach) address spaces are passed to that core object.
42 Requests to transfer (DMA) data are reflected back down the device
43 tree using the core_map data transfer methods.
44
45 PROPERTIES
46
47 None.
48
49 */
